Key Terminology
-
SCSI (Ultra-2)
-
A parallel Small Computer System Interface standard using Low Voltage Differential signaling designed for higher data-transfer speeds and longer cable lengths in enterprise storage environments.
-
Modem (33.6k)
-
Refers to a dial-up modem speed of approximately 33.6 kilobits per second, typical of V.34-class analog telephone line connections.
